What is financial data management?
Career: Financial Data Manager
Financial data management involves collecting, organizing, and maintaining financial information to ensure accuracy, security, and accessibility for analysis and reporting. It often requires proficiency with database tools, spreadsheets, and financial software, and is essential for informed decision-making in finance roles like a Financial Data Manager.
